免费论文查重: 大雅 万方 维普 turnitin paperpass

试议以计算思维为导向计算机基础教学方案

最后更新时间:2024-02-09 作者:用户投稿原创标记本站原创 点赞:5509 浏览:15695
论文导读:
【摘要】计算思维代表着一种普遍的认识和一类普适的技能,对计算思维的培养已经成为当前教育的一个重要目标。将“计算思维”引入教学中,是当前我们面对的教育教学技术改革的新挑战、更是机遇。计算机基础教学在实现大学教育目标方面起着非常重要的作用,计算机基础教学为学生创新能力的培养奠定基础。本文探讨了基于计算思维的大学计算机基础课程教学方案。
【关键词】计算机基础;教学方案;计算思维

1.计算思维简介

随着计算机科学的迅速发展,计算思维作为理由求解、系统设计和人类行为理解的一种思维方式受到广泛关注。计算思维(Computational Thinking)是由美国卡内基·梅隆大学计算机科学系主任周以真(Jeannette M.Wing)教授在2006年3月在美国计算机权威期刊《Communications of the ACM》杂志上给出和定义。
国际21世纪教育委员会向联合国教科文组织提交的报告中指出,教育应围绕四种基本学习加以安排:一是学会认知,即学会学习;二是学会做事;三是学会共同生活;四是学会存活。从计算机基础教学能力培养目标看,涉及计算机学科专业能力的是:对计算机的认知能力和应用计算机的理由求解能力。这两方面的能力恰好反映了计算思维的两个核心要素:计算环境和理由求解。

2.计算机基础教学的基本定位

计算机基础教学不仅要培养学生对计算环境的认识,更重要的应该培养学生掌握在计算环境下的理由求解策略,这是今后学生应用计算机技术解决专业理由的重要基础。另外,计算思维能力的培养还展现了计算机学科独特的思维方式,为将来创新性地解决专业理由奠定基础。以计算思维能力培养作为计算机基础教学的核心任务,不仅紧紧围绕现有计算机基础教学的根本任务和核心知识内容,而且反映了计算机学科的本质,也体现了通识教育应有的特征。显然,这样的教学定位,不仅摆脱了以“操作技能”培养学生计算机能力造成的“危机”,也更好地诠释了课程建设的目标,更好地体现了计算机基础课程的基础特征。
计算机基础教学在实现大学教育目标方面起着非常重要的作用。表现在:计算机不仅为解决专业领域理由提供有效的策略和手段,而且提供了一种独特的处理理由的思维方式;计算机及互联网有了极其丰富的信息和知识资源,为终生学习提供了广阔的空间以及良好的学习工具;善于使用互联网和办公软件是培养良好的交流表达能力和团队合作能力的重要基础;在信息社会里,计算机使用者的道德规范与社会责任是培养良好道德情操和社会责任感的重要内容。因此,计算机基础教学不仅是大学通识教育的重要组成部分,更在大学生全面素质教育和能力培养中承担着重要的职责。
高素质的创新人才是国家建设所不可缺少的。复合型的知识结构、良好的思维方式以及勇于探索的实践能力是创新人才的重要特征。大学计算机基础教学为学生创新能力的培养奠定了基础,不仅承载着优化大学生知识结构的使命,也是培养大学动手实践能力的重要课程载体,更是训练大学生掌握计算机学科领域独特思维方式的教学内容。计算机基础教学在我国高等教育中已有30多年的发展历史,已经成为我国高等教育的必定组成部分,在学生综合素质、创新能力培养方面发挥着重要作用。

3.具体做法

计算思维代表着一种普遍的认识和一类普适的技能,将发挥越来越大的作用,因此,对计算思维的培养已经成为当前教育的一个重要目标。针对这一目标,本课题面向应用型本科院校的学生,对大学计算机基础课程的教学方案、教育技术进行调整,采用任务驱动教学法,依托精心设计的教学内容、教学过程和科学的考核方式,使学生构建起基本的信息素养与学习能力,能够“自觉”的学习计算机的相关技术和知识,以达到有兴趣和会用计算机来解决理由,培养他们对复杂事物进行抽样、分解的能力,并能够将复杂理由归纳至他们熟悉的简单理由上去,终身受益。
以实践为主线、以计算思维为导向,从教学策略与手段的改革与创新入手,在不弱化“计算机软件的使用”的前提下,提升到“计算思维”训练的层面,全面提升学生的综合能力。围绕以下三个方面开展课程的教育教学技术研究和实践:
(1)结合教学团队建设,构建计算机文化素养平台。
从计算机文化素养的角度进行整体教学设计,如计算机发展历程、图灵奖、计算机硬件设备展台,还有组织学生进行微机组装实验以及市场调研等活动。从计算机文化素养的角度进行整体教学设计,如计算机发展历程、图灵奖、计算机硬件设备展台,组织学生进行微机组装实验以及市场调研等活动。建立“开放性的实验环境”,供学生随时上机实验,以转变传统教学策略中理论讲解与实际操作内容不同步的矛盾。
(2)按分类分层的原则进行教学内容重组;优化课堂教学结构。
我校在校学生有本科和专科层次的学生,有理科专业(数、理、化)和文科专业(中文、英语、政治、教育等),还包括艺体类专业(美术、音乐和体育),层次和类别较多。以前计算机基础课程传统的教学模式是不同层次、不同专业的学生采用相同的教学大纲,讲授相同的内容,采用统一的考核和评价体制,造成的直接影响是本科层次的理科类学生“吃不饱”,而专科类的文科及艺体类学生不能“消化”,这是教师和学生都不愿接受的事实。在分层教学思想的指导下,我们就课程体系、教学内容、教学策略、实践环节及考核方式上进行了一系列的改革,形成了一套适应我校具体情况的教学体系,取得了理想的效果,也为同类兄弟院校的计算机基础课程的教学提供了参考依据。
根据“1+X”课程设置方案中的课程整合要求,按照各专业的培养目标,对计算机基础所要讲述的内容提出相应调整方案。
一是根据文科和理科专业不同的需求特点,实行按文科、理科等不同的学科制定不同的教学大纲,分开授课,以满足不同学科对计算机基础知识的不同需求。
二是根据学生基础进行分层。随着中小学对信息技术的重视以及地区上的差异,学生进校时的计算机水平有了很大的变化:鉴于此,采用普通班、提高班及特色班,学生根据自己的实际情况、兴趣爱好、学习能力,自主选择班级,实行动态管理。
在计算机基础课程的教学改革中,将我校的在校学生按学历分为三个层论文导读:zer,etal.computationalsocialscience.science,february,2009.上一页12
次:本科、专科及函授。针对不同学历层次的学生,在教学时间和内容上均不相同。根据文科、理科及艺体类专业不同的需求,分别组织教学内容,制定教学大纲,确立我校的计算机基础课程体系结构。
(3)加强教学策略与手段的改革与创新,培养学生计算机文化素养、应用计算机和计算思维解决实际理由的基本能力。
在计算思维能力教学中,需要对计算思维重新阐释成如何开展教学的理由,简单地说:应用计算机解决理由的意识和能力。
参考文献
[1]九校联盟(c9)计算机基础教学发展战略联合声明[J].中国大学教学,2010(9).
[2]jeannettem.wing.computational thinking[J].communicationsoftheacm,march2006.
[3]jeannettem.wing.computationalthinkingand thinkingaboutcomputing philosophical transactions[J].seriesa,july,2008.
[4]jancuny,larrysnyder,jeannettem.wing.demystifyingctfornon-computer scientists[J].workinprogress,2010.
[5]李廉.计算思维——概念与挑战[J].中国大学教学,2012 (1).
[6]karprm.understandingsciencethroughthe computationallens[J].journalofcomputerscienceandtechnology,july2011,26(4).
[7]did lazer,et al.computational social science[J].science,february,2009.